Input Registers
The following registers are used as inputs to the function block. They select the options
and define the parameters that the user needs to make the Home function work as
necessary.
Input Type Description Range and state
ENABLE Bit Block enable – Block cannot
execute unless this is TRUE.
Rising Edge – see operation notes
TRUE – Block enable
FALSE – Block disable
CAMIN Bit Sets block to search for
ENGAGE position in master.
When reached axis begins
camming
RISING EDGE- initiates search for
engage position and sets up for
camming
CAMOUT Bit Sets block to search for
DISENGAG position in master.
When reached axis stops and
holds.
RISING EDGE- initiates search for
disengage position and stops
camming and holds when position
is reached by master.
RECOVRY Bit Start Recovery Motion when E-
stop occurred.
RISING EDGE- initiates the
recovery motion.
AXIS Word Axis number related to the block 1 to 16
M-S-PAIR Word Master Slave Pair as defined by
the RDA
1 to 10 integer. This value is
needed to match the value of the
MOD-ENG function block.
TBLTYPE Word Defines what register type the
cam table will be in. CAM table
consists of 32-bit long integer
words
1 = M registers
2 = C registers
3 = D registers
TBLADDRS Word Starting address number of the
cam table.
In case of D register table, this
value is relative to the assigned
data address at ‘DATA31W’.
TBLADDRS+DATA31W
= Actual Starting Address
03276
If the end of the table is greater
than 32767, the an error will be
set.
(The limit of M-reg is MW00000 to
MW29999)
ENGAGPO
S
Long Master position in counts to start
the slave camming
0 to the machine cycle value
defined in the MOD-ENG block
DISENGAG Long Master position in counts to stop
the slave camming
0 to the machine cycle value
defined in the MOD-ENG block
DATA32W Addres
s
Address of the first working
register.
Thirty-two words of register space
are used by this function.
